Spaces:
Sleeping
Sleeping
File size: 6,073 Bytes
54fa6eb 8da3ac8 54fa6eb f2389fe 182e8fe f2389fe 182e8fe f2389fe 54fa6eb 8da3ac8 54fa6eb 6c209d9 da5e479 54fa6eb f2389fe 54fa6eb 4eeb29b 54fa6eb |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 |
# llm configs
llm:
api_key:
model_name: "gpt-4o"
default_temperature: 0.8
default_max_tokens: 3000
default_system_message: |
You are a marketing assistant generating personalized newsletter content.
You will generate multiple sections of text that will be integrated into an HTML newsletter template.
You will write in first person.
For each section, ensure the content is coherent with the provided context and personalization parameters.
Format your response as a JSON-like structure with clear section demarcations.
Structure your response exactly as follows:
{
"greeting": "your greeting text here",
"intro": "your intro text here",
"recommendations": "your recommendations text here",
"closing": "your closing text here"
}
default_few_shot: |
{
"greeting": "Hello [customer name]",
"intro": "It's such a pleasure to reconnect with you! Your selections, such as the [item] and the [item], were such standout choices. I’d love to help you discover more pieces that complement your impeccable style.",
"recommendations": "Based on your recent purchases, I thought you might love the [item] as a stylish addition to your wardrobe. Available in classic Black and versatile Blue, these trousers effortlessly combine style and comfort, making them perfect for any occasion. Have you considered adding a touch of denim to your collection?",
"closing": "These pieces are going to look absolutely stunning on you, [customer name]. Can't wait to hear what you think. Talk soon!"
}
####
{
"greeting": "Hello [customer name]",
"intro": "It's a pleasure to connect with you again! Your choices, like the [item] in Lilac Purple and the [item] in White, were fantastic. I'd love to help you discover even more pieces to love.",
"recommendations": "Following your recent selections, I thought the [item] might be a perfect addition to your wardrobe. Available in both classic Black and versatile Blue, these trousers are both stylish and comfortable—ideal for any occasion. Have you considered adding denim to your collection?",
"closing": "I hope these selections inspire your personal style, [customer name]. Looking forward to our next curated moment together."
}
####
{
"greeting": "Dear [customer name]",
"intro": "I wanted to take a moment to thank you for your recent beautiful selection, including the [item] and the [item]. These designs are timeless additions that will effortlessly match your wardrobe.",
"recommendations": "I've selected a few pieces that I believe will resonate with your style. The [item] brings a touch of refined elegance and pairs beautifully with the [item] you love. The [item] are a stylish complement, adding just the right amount of flair to complete your look. These pieces are versatile choices to enhance your style.",
"closing": "I hope these selections inspire your personal style, [customer name]. Looking forward to our next curated moment together."
}
####
{
"greeting": "Dear [customer name]",
"intro": "Your recent purchases, like the [Celestial Glimmer Necklace] and the [item], are remarkable additions. They are beautiful pieces that will perfectly match any look.",
"recommendations": "Here are a few pieces I thought you might love. The [item] is the perfect blend of sophistication and versatility, a beautiful match for the [item]. To complete the look, the [item] offer a chic edge that's both stylish and timeless",
"closing": "Thanks for letting me share these finds with you, [customer name]. I can't wait to see how you style them. Until next time, stay fabulous!"
}
####
{
"greeting": "Dear [customer name]",
"intro": "The [item] and the [item] from your recent selections are simply amazing. They're perfect for adding a touch of elegance and versatility to your wardrobe",
"recommendations": "I've picked out a couple of pieces that I think you'll appreciate. The [item] is a versatile addition, perfect for pairing with your current shorts for a polished yet effortless look. The [item] is another great option—it's easy to style and works seamlessly with almost anything. These pieces are ideal for refreshing and adding a touch of versatility to your outfits.",
"closing": "Excited to be part of your style journey, [customer name]. These pieces are just waiting to make your wardrobe shine. Until our next conversation, stay wonderful!"
}
####
{
"greeting": "Hello [customer name]",
"intro": "Your recent choices, like the [item] and the [item], reflect such effortless style. Both are standout pieces that bring versatility and sophistication to your collection.",
"recommendations": "I've selected a few pieces I think you'll love. The [item] is a perfect pairing with your shorts, creating a polished yet casual look. The [item] is another excellent addition, easy to style and ideal for mixing and matching. Both are perfect for bringing a fresh, stylish variety to your wardrobe.",
"closing": "Can't wait to see these pieces come to life in your wardrobe, [customer name]! Looking forward to our next style adventure. Stay chic!"
}
recommender_api:
base_url:
key:
# app frontend
app:
server_port: 7860
share: false
# templates for newsletters and prompts
newsletter:
newsletter_example_path: "./newsletter_examples/2.html"
brand_logo: "https://seeklogo.com/images/L/luisa-spagnoli-logo-EF482BEE89-seeklogo.com.png"
brand_name: "Luisa Spagnoli"
max_recommendations: 2
max_recents_items: 2
# logo luisa spagnoli https://seeklogo.com/images/L/luisa-spagnoli-logo-EF482BEE89-seeklogo.com.png
# logo h&m https://upload.wikimedia.org/wikipedia/commons/thumb/5/53/H%26M-Logo.svg/709px-H%26M-Logo.svg.png |